The Expanded Food and Nutrition Education Program (EFNEP) is a nationally recognized and research-based program that equips families and individuals with the knowledge and skills to make healthy and affordable food choices.

EFNEP is funded by the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) and operates in partnership with land-grant universities and local organizations.

Consistently, data shows that more than 90 percent of adults and 80 percent of youth report improved behaviors following EFNEP involvement. Individual and family improvements are seen in four core areas:

  • Diet quality and physical activity
  • Food resource management
  • Food safety
  • Food security
